This Lumberjack Chili crockpot recipe is a hearty and satisfying meal that's perfect for warming up on a chilly day. Its rich flavors and tender bits of meat combined with a medley of beans and spices make it a crowd-pleaser that will leave everyone asking for seconds. Tribute to my sweet Mom

I developed my love of cooking at an early age “helping” my Mom bake cookies, make dinner, and knead bread. She had quite the well of patience! She is the one that taught me about measurements, leavening agents, egg-washes, the basic white sauce, and numerous other mysteries of the kitchen!  I cherish the memories I have of learning to cook at her side.
